Mykal Walker

He played college football for the Azusa Pacific Cougars and Fresno State Bulldogs and was selected by the Atlanta Falcons in the fourth round of the 2020 NFL draft.

Walker has also been a member of the Chicago Bears, Las Vegas Raiders, and Pittsburgh Steelers.

Walker played two seasons at Azusa Pacific University before transferring to Fresno State.

[1] Walker was selected by the Atlanta Falcons with the 119th overall pick in the fourth round of the 2020 NFL draft.

[3] In Week 14 of the 2021 season, Walker intercepted Cam Newton and returned it 66 yards for a touchdown in a 29-21 win over the Carolina Panthers.
